CORIOLUS VERSICOLOR EXTRACT

Description

Coriolus versicolor extract, derived from the Turkey Tail mushroom, is a potent bioactive ingredient gaining traction in skincare formulations. This fungal extract is rich in polysaccharides, particularly protein-bound beta-glucans, which exhibit significant antioxidant and immunomodulatory properties. These compounds help neutralize free radicals and support the skin's natural defense mechanisms against environmental stressors.

Research indicates that Coriolus versicolor extract may enhance collagen production and improve skin elasticity, potentially reducing the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les. Its anti-inflammatory properties can help soothe irritated skin and may be beneficial in managing conditions like acne and rosacea. The extract also demonstrates antimicrobial activity, which could contribute to maintaining a healthy skin microbiome.

In skincare formulations, Coriolus versicolor extract is typically used at concentrations between 0.1% and 2%. It is compatible with a wide range of cosmetic ingredients and stable in various pH levels. The extract is water-soluble, making it easy to incorporate into serums, lotions, and creams. While generally well-tolerated, patch testing is recommended for individuals with sensitive skin or known fungal allergies.
